The storyline centers on Akhandanand Tripathi, a wealthy carpet exporter and mafia don, and the volatile ambitions of his son, Munna. Complications arise when an innocent encounter pulls a well-meaning family into the menacing world of crime, leading to a gripping struggle for power.

The show follows the intertwined lives of a police officer and a notorious gangster in Mumbai, as they navigate the complex web of corruption, politics, and religious tension. With its gripping storyline and nuanced characters, Sacred Games takes viewers on a thrilling and thought-provoking journey that explores the dark underbelly of the city.

Pankaj Tripathi Biography
Pankaj Tripathi is an Indian actor known for his work in Hindi films. Born on September 28, 1976, he studied acting at the National School of Drama. Tripathi began his career with minor roles in films like Omkara, Raavan, and Agneepath, and had a supporting role in the television series Powder. He gained recognition for his role in Gangs of Wasseypur and went on to star in notable supporting roles in movies like Fukrey, Masaan, and Bareilly Ki Barfi. Tripathi has also appeared in leading roles in streaming series such as Mirzapur and Criminal Justice, and in the film Kaagaz. He has received several awards for his performances, including two National Film Awards and a Filmfare Award.
